429 * L2C-310 specific code.
431 * Very similar to L2C-210, the PA, set/way and sync operations are atomic,
432 * and the way operations are all background tasks. However, issuing an
433 * operation while a background operation is in progress results in a
434 * SLVERR response. We can reuse:
436 * __l2c210_cache_sync (using sync_reg_offset)
438 * l2c210_inv_range (if 588369 is not applicable)
440 * l2c210_flush_range (if 588369 is not applicable)
441 * l2c210_flush_all (if 727915 is not applicable)
444 * 588369: PL310 R0P0->R1P0, fixed R2P0.
445 * Affects: all clean+invalidate operations
446 * clean and invalidate skips the invalidate step, so we need to issue
447 * separate operations. We also require the above debug workaround
448 * enclosing this code fragment on affected parts. On unaffected parts,
449 * we must not use this workaround without the debug register writes
450 * to avoid exposing a problem similar to 727915.
452 * 727915: PL310 R2P0->R3P0, fixed R3P1.
453 * Affects: clean+invalidate by way
454 * clean and invalidate by way runs in the background, and a store can
455 * hit the line between the clean operation and invalidate operation,
456 * resulting in the store being lost.
458 * 752271: PL310 R3P0->R3P1-50REL0, fixed R3P2.
459 * Affects: 8x64-bit (double fill) line fetches
460 * double fill line fetches can fail to cause dirty data to be evicted
461 * from the cache before the new data overwrites the second line.
463 * 753970: PL310 R3P0, fixed R3P1.
465 * prevents merging writes after the sync operation, until another L2C
466 * operation is performed (or a number of other conditions.)
468 * 769419: PL310 R0P0->R3P1, fixed R3P2.
469 * Affects: store buffer
470 * store buffer is not automatically drained.

1536 * For certain Broadcom SoCs, depending on the address range, different offsets
1537 * need to be added to the address before passing it to L2 for
1538 * invalidation/clean/flush
1540 * Section Address Range Offset EMI
1541 * 1 0x00000000 - 0x3FFFFFFF 0x80000000 VC
1542 * 2 0x40000000 - 0xBFFFFFFF 0x40000000 SYS
1543 * 3 0xC0000000 - 0xFFFFFFFF 0x80000000 VC
1545 * When the start and end addresses have crossed two different sections, we
1546 * need to break the L2 operation into two, each within its own section.
1547 * For example, if we need to invalidate addresses starts at 0xBFFF0000 and
1548 * ends at 0xC0001000, we need do invalidate 1) 0xBFFF0000 - 0xBFFFFFFF and 2)
1549 * 0xC0000000 - 0xC0001000
1552 * By breaking a single L2 operation into two, we may potentially suffer some
1553 * performance hit, but keep in mind the cross section case is very rare
1556 * We do not need to handle the case when the start address is in
1557 * Section 1 and the end address is in Section 3, since it is not a valid use
1561 * Section 1 in practical terms can no longer be used on rev A2. Because of
1562 * that the code does not need to handle section 1 at all.
